A prominent law firm in the UK seeks an experienced Principal Associate to join its Cambridge office and manage high-profile commercial projects. This role requires at least 7 years PQE in commercial law, ideally with experience in government contracting.

The successful candidate will:

  • Mentor team members
  • Lead significant projects
  • Develop innovative contract structures
  • Maintain strong client relationships

A competitive salary and comprehensive benefits are offered in an inclusive working environment.
